  Haiku Bridge
 


Download Complete Winemaker Notes
 
 

Haiku Bridge is produced by Remy Pannier, the most trusted name in Loire Valley wines since 1885. Recognizing the growing interest in food and wine pairing, Remy Pannier has developed Haiku Bridge in conjunction with a team of top Japanese chefs. Their goal was to create a harmonious, refreshing and delicately fruity wine that would be an ideal partner for Japanese cuisine and an array of other Asian-inspired dishes. Winemaker Karine Huibant and Remy Pannier are pleased to present the result, made from 100% Chenin Blanc grapes.

Production Area
From vineyards in France’s Loire Valley

Grape Varieties
100% Chenin Blanc

Color
Pale gold with green highlights

Bouquet
Aromas of lime, green apple and grapefruit peel

Taste
Medium-bodied and refreshing, with vibrant fruit flavors and a zesty acidity

Alcohol
11.5%

Serving Suggestions
Served chilled, this wine is a perfect match with sushi, sashimi and range of Japanese dishes. Also delicious served fresh seafood and spicy fare.
